Delta E (ΔE)
A measure of how different two colors look. Below 1 the difference is invisible to almost everyone; below 2.3 most people can't tell them apart; above 10 they are clearly different colors. We use CIEDE2000, the modern standard.Full glossary entry →

RAL values are widely published approximations of the physical standard. For Pantone-adjacent workflows, match by eye against a physical fan deck. Pantone's values are proprietary and device-dependent, so we don't print lookups.

What color is Shipmate?
Shipmate is a medium blue with the hex code #7AA3CC. In HSL terms it has a hue of 210°, 45% saturation, and 64% lightness.
What is the hex code for Shipmate?
The hex code for Shipmate is #7AA3CC. In RGB it's rgb(122, 163, 204), and in CMYK it's cmyk(40%, 20%, 0%, 20%).
